为什么服务器网卡无法启动并显示失败?

服务器网卡无法启动失败

一、问题

服务器网卡无法启动失败

服务器网卡无法启动是一个常见的问题,可能由多种因素引起,网卡作为服务器与网络连接的桥梁,其稳定性和可靠性对服务器的正常运行至关重要,当网卡无法启动时,服务器将无法与外部网络通信,导致服务中断、数据传输受阻等严重后果,本文将从多个方面深入分析服务器网卡无法启动的原因,并提供相应的解决方案。

二、常见原因分析

1. 硬件故障

网卡损坏:网卡本身可能存在物理损坏,如电路烧毁、接口松动等。

插槽问题:服务器主板上的网卡插槽可能因长时间使用或灰尘积累导致接触不良。

连接线缆故障:网线或光纤等连接线缆可能出现断裂、损坏或接触不良的情况。

2. 驱动问题

驱动程序未安装或损坏:网卡需要正确的驱动程序才能正常工作,如果驱动程序未安装或损坏,网卡将无法启动。

服务器网卡无法启动失败

驱动程序不兼容:某些旧型号的网卡可能不支持新的操作系统或系统更新,导致驱动程序不兼容。

3. 配置问题

IP地址冲突:如果服务器的IP地址与其他设备冲突,可能导致网卡无法正常启动。

网络设置错误:错误的网络设置,如子网掩码、网关地址等,也可能导致网卡无法启动。

4. 软件冲突

安全软件拦截:某些安全软件可能会拦截网卡的正常工作,导致网卡无法启动。

系统服务冲突:系统中的某些服务可能与网卡服务产生冲突,影响网卡的启动。

服务器网卡无法启动失败

5. 操作系统问题

系统文件损坏:操作系统中的关键文件损坏可能导致网卡无法正常启动。

系统更新问题:某些系统更新可能引入了与网卡不兼容的更改,导致网卡无法启动。

三、解决方案

1. 检查硬件连接

确保网卡正确插入服务器主板的插槽中。

检查网线或光纤等连接线缆是否完好无损,并确保连接牢固。

如果可能,尝试更换网卡或插槽进行测试。

2. 更新或重新安装驱动程序

访问网卡制造商的官方网站,下载并安装适用于当前操作系统的最新驱动程序。

如果已经安装了驱动程序,尝试卸载后重新安装。

3. 检查网络配置

确保服务器的IP地址、子网掩码、网关地址等网络设置正确无误。

使用ipconfigifconfig命令检查网络配置信息。

4. 禁用安全软件

临时禁用防火墙、杀毒软件等安全软件,以排除它们对网卡的拦截。

如果禁用安全软件后网卡能够正常启动,可以考虑调整安全软件的配置或更换其他安全软件。

5. 检查系统服务和日志

使用services.mscsystemctl命令检查与网卡相关的系统服务是否正常运行。

查看系统日志(如Windows的事件查看器或Linux的syslog),以获取有关网卡启动失败的详细信息。

6. 恢复系统或重装操作系统

如果以上方法都无法解决问题,可以考虑恢复系统备份或重装操作系统,但请注意,这将导致数据丢失,请提前做好数据备份工作。

四、预防措施

定期检查和维护服务器硬件和软件环境。

确保使用最新版本的驱动程序和操作系统补丁。

定期备份重要数据和系统配置信息。

加强网络安全管理,防止恶意软件攻击导致系统故障。

五、案例分析

案例一:IP地址冲突导致的网卡启动失败

某企业服务器在启动时发现网卡无法正常启动,经过检查发现是IP地址冲突导致的,通过修改服务器的IP地址并确保其唯一性后,网卡成功启动并恢复正常工作。

案例二:驱动程序不兼容导致的网卡启动失败

一台老旧的服务器在进行系统升级后发现网卡无法启动,经过排查发现是新安装的操作系统与旧网卡的驱动程序不兼容,通过下载并安装适用于新操作系统的网卡驱动程序后,问题得到解决。

六、相关问题与解答

问题1:如何更改网卡的MAC地址?

答:更改网卡的MAC地址通常涉及修改系统的网络配置文件或使用特定的软件工具,以下是在Linux系统中更改MAC地址的步骤:

1、找到要更改的网卡名称,例如eth0ens33

2、编辑网卡对应的配置文件,通常位于/etc/sysconfig/network-scripts/目录下,文件名以ifcfg开头,后接网卡名称。

3、在配置文件中找到HWADDRMACADDR这一行,并将其值更改为新的MAC地址。

4、保存配置文件并重启网络服务或系统,使更改生效。

问题2:什么是网卡的MTU,如何优化它?

答:MTU(Maximum Transmission Unit)是指网络传输中的最大数据包大小,单位为字节,它表示在网络上传输的最大数据帧大小,不包括链路层的头部和尾部。

要查找当前系统的MTU值,可以使用以下命令:

ip link show(对于较新的Linux发行版)

ifconfig -a(对于较旧的Linux发行版)

要优化MTU值,通常需要进行MTU发现或手动调整MTU值,MTU发现是一种动态调整MTU的过程,以确保在特定网络路径上实现最佳的传输效率,以下是在Linux系统中进行MTU发现的步骤:

1、打开终端并以root用户身份登录(如果尚未以root用户登录)。

2、使用ip mtu discover [目标IP或主机名]命令进行MTU发现,如果要与example.com进行MTU发现,可以使用以下命令:ip mtu discover example.com

3、等待一段时间后,系统会自动完成MTU发现过程,并显示推荐的MTU值。

4、根据推荐的MTU值,可以手动调整网络接口的MTU设置,如果推荐的MTU值是1400字节,可以使用以下命令将其应用到eth0接口:ip link set dev eth0 mtu 1400

5、保存MTU设置并在必要时重启网络服务或系统以使更改生效。

到此,以上就是小编对于“服务器网卡无法启动失败”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/708040.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-12-06 01:51
Next 2024-12-06 01:55

相关推荐

  • 如何重置服务器连接?

    服务器连接重置是网络通信中常见的问题,它可能由多种因素引起,包括但不限于网络配置错误、硬件故障、软件问题或外部网络干扰,以下是一些详细的步骤和建议,用于解决服务器连接重置的问题:1、检查网络连接 - 确保服务器和客户端的网络连接正常,可以尝试使用ping命令测试服务器的连通性, - 如果网络连接不稳定,尝试重新……

    2024-11-06
    07
  • 为什么我的AR5B195设备无法连接到网络?

    ar5b195搜不到网络”这一问题,可能的原因有多种,以下是一些常见的问题及其解决方法:常见原因及解决方法1、驱动程序问题: - 确保已经安装了适用于AR5B195网卡的最新驱动程序,如果未安装或驱动程序过时,可能会导致无法搜索到网络, - 如果已安装最新驱动但仍有问题,尝试卸载后重新安装,或者使用驱动精灵等工……

    2024-11-28
    07
  • 为什么服务器无法读取串口数据?

    服务器无法读取串口数据可能由多种原因造成,这里将详细解释一些常见的问题及其解决方案:1、硬件连接问题:首先检查串口线缆是否正确连接到服务器和设备上,确保没有松动或损坏的情况发生,如果使用的是USB转串口适配器,请尝试更换一个以确保不是转换器本身的问题,2、驱动程序问题:对于基于操作系统的串口通信来说,正确的驱动……

    2024-11-28
    06
  • 服务器加装显卡后为何不被识别?

    服务器加装显卡后无法识别,这是一个常见的问题,可能由多种原因造成,以下是一些可能的原因及其相应的解决方法:1、驱动程序问题原因:显卡需要正确的驱动程序才能正常工作,如果驱动安装不正确或者过时,可能导致显卡无法识别,解决方法:从显卡制造商的官方网站下载并安装最新的驱动程序,2、硬件兼容性问题原因:某些设备可能与服……

    2024-11-20
    09
  • 为何ECS无法成功连接到本地MySQL数据库?探究GaussDB(for MySQL)实例连接失败的原因

    ECS无法连接到GaussDB(for MySQL)实例的原因可能有以下几点:,,1. 网络问题:请检查ECS与GaussDB(for MySQL)实例之间的网络连接是否正常。,2. 防火墙设置:请检查ECS和GaussDB(for MySQL)实例的防火墙设置,确保允许彼此之间的连接。,3. 权限问题:请检查ECS上使用的用户名和密码是否正确,以及该用户是否具有访问GaussDB(for MySQL)实例的权限。,4. 数据库配置:请检查GaussDB(for MySQL)实例的配置,确保允许外部连接。

    2024-07-26
    065
  • 服务器为何无法识别到阵列?原因何在?

    服务器无法识别阵列的问题可能由多种因素引起,以下是详细的分析和解决步骤:1、硬件连接问题检查数据线和电源线:确保服务器与阵列之间的所有数据线和电源线连接正确且稳固,松动或损坏的连接可能导致阵列无法被识别,检查硬件故障:硬件组件如硬盘、RAID控制器或连接线可能出现故障,检查硬件的状态指示灯,如有异常,需及时更换……

    2024-11-28
    03

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入